Johnson Outdoors to Exit Eureka Business, Focus on Jetboil
Johnson Outdoors announced that it is exiting its Eureka product lines to focus on the cooking segment, including its Jetboil franchise. Eureka was founded in 1895 as Eureka Tent & Awning Company in Binghamton, New York. Johnson acquired the business in 1973. Its...
